Define a variable and write an inequality for each problem and then solve.

42. The product of a -4 and a number is at least 35.

1Step 1 - Define the variable.

A variable is a term that is used to represent an unknown value.

2Step 2 - Write the inequality.

From given, let the number multiplied to -4 be x.

As the product is at least 35. 

So, the inequality is:

-4×x35

3Step 3 - Solve the inequality.

Simplify the inequality as shown below:

4×x35x354x8.75

Therefore, the inequality is -4×x35 and the value of x is x-8.75.
